+/* Any copyright is dedicated to the Public Domain.
+ * http://creativecommons.org/publicdomain/zero/1.0/ */
+
+"use strict";
+
+const { Preferences } = ChromeUtils.importESModule(
+ "resource://gre/modules/Preferences.sys.mjs"
+);
+
+// List of default preferences that can be used for tests, chosen because they
+// have little or no side-effects when they are modified for a brief time. If
+// any of these preferences are removed or their default state changes, just
+// update the constant to point to a different preference with the same default.
+const PREF_BOOLEAN_DEFAULT_TRUE = "accessibility.typeaheadfind.manual";
+const PREF_BOOLEAN_USERVALUE_TRUE = "browser.dom.window.dump.enabled";
+const PREF_NUMBER_DEFAULT_ZERO = "accessibility.typeaheadfind.casesensitive";
+const PREF_STRING_DEFAULT_EMPTY = "browser.helperApps.neverAsk.openFile";
+const PREF_STRING_DEFAULT_NOTEMPTY = "accessibility.typeaheadfind.soundURL";
+const PREF_STRING_DEFAULT_NOTEMPTY_VALUE = "beep";
+const PREF_STRING_LOCALIZED_MISSING = "intl.menuitems.alwaysappendaccesskeys";
+
+// Other preference names used in tests.
+const PREF_NEW = "test.aboutconfig.new";
+
+// These tests can be slow to execute because they show all the preferences
+// several times, and each time can require a second on some virtual machines.
+requestLongerTimeout(2);
+
+class AboutConfigRowTest {
+ constructor(element) {
+ this.element = element;
+ }
+
+ querySelector(selector) {
+ return this.element.querySelector(selector);
+ }
+
+ get nameCell() {
+ return this.querySelector("th");
+ }
+
+ get name() {
+ return this.nameCell.textContent;
+ }
+
+ get valueCell() {
+ return this.querySelector("td.cell-value");
+ }
+
+ get value() {
+ return this.valueCell.textContent;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Text input field when the row is in edit mode.
+ */
+ get valueInput() {
+ return this.valueCell.querySelector("input");
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* This is normally "edit" or "toggle" based on the preference type, "save"
+ * when the row is in edit mode, or "add" when the preference does not exist.
+ */
+ get editColumnButton() {
+ return this.querySelector("td.cell-edit > button");
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* This can be "reset" or "delete" based on whether a default exists.
+ */
+ get resetColumnButton() {
+ return this.querySelector("td:last-child > button");
+ }
+
+ hasClass(className) {
+ return this.element.classList.contains(className);
+ }
+}
+
+class AboutConfigTest {
+ static withNewTab(testFn, options = {}) {
+ return BrowserTestUtils.withNewTab(
+ {
+ gBrowser,
+ url: "chrome://global/content/aboutconfig/aboutconfig.html",
+ },
+ async browser => {
+ let scope = new this(browser);
+ await scope.setupNewTab(options);
+ await testFn.call(scope);
+ }
+ );
+ }
+
+ constructor(browser) {
+ this.browser = browser;
+ this.document = browser.contentDocument;
+ this.window = browser.contentWindow;
+ }
+
+ async setupNewTab(options) {
+ await this.document.l10n.ready;
+ if (!options.dontBypassWarning) {
+ this.bypassWarningButton.click();
+ this.showAll();
+ }
+ }
+
+ get showWarningNextTimeInput() {
+ return this.document.getElementById("showWarningNextTime");
+ }
+
+ get bypassWarningButton() {
+ return this.document.getElementById("warningButton");
+ }
+
+ get searchInput() {
+ return this.document.getElementById("about-config-search");
+ }
+
+ get showOnlyModifiedCheckbox() {
+ return this.document.getElementById("about-config-show-only-modified");
+ }
+
+ get prefsTable() {
+ return this.document.getElementById("prefs");
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Array of AboutConfigRowTest objects, one for each row in the main table.
+ */
+ get rows() {
+ let elements = this.prefsTable.querySelectorAll("tr:not(.hidden)");
+ return Array.from(elements, element => new AboutConfigRowTest(element));
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Returns the AboutConfigRowTest object for the row in the main table which
+ * corresponds to the given preference name, or undefined if none is present.
+ */
+ getRow(name) {
+ return this.rows.find(row => row.name == name);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Shows all preferences using the dedicated button.
+ */
+ showAll() {
+ this.search("");
+ this.document.getElementById("show-all").click();
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Performs a new search using the dedicated textbox. This also makes sure
+ * that the list of preferences displayed is up to date.
+ */
+ search(value) {
+ this.searchInput.value = value;
+ this.searchInput.focus();
+ EventUtils.sendKey("return");
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Checks whether or not the initial warning page is displayed.
+ */
+ assertWarningPage(expected) {
+ Assert.equal(!!this.showWarningNextTimeInput, expected);
+ Assert.equal(!!this.bypassWarningButton, expected);
+ Assert.equal(!this.searchInput, expected);
+ Assert.equal(!this.prefsTable, expected);
+ }
+}
